Police officers from the Giurgiu Territorial Inspectorate of the Border Police together with Bulgarian police officers detected, during a joint operation carried out on national road 5 (DN 5), two people of Afghan and Iraqi origin who were trying to illegally cross the border, the General Inspectorate of the Border Police informs on Tuesday.
The migrants were hidden in a specially arranged compartment in a bus.
The bus drivers, two Turkish citizens, are being held in preventive arrest for 30 days, as they are under investigation for migrant smuggling.
"On July 27, 2025, at around 2:20 am, as part of a Blitz-type action, the Giurgiu border police, in collaboration with the Bulgarian police, stopped on DN 5, for control, a bus registered in Turkey, which was traveling on the Turkey-Germany route. The bus was driven a Turkish citizen, accompanied by a backup driver. Following the inspection of the means of transport, in the drivers' rest compartment, the police identified a specially arranged place, where two male persons, aged 47 and 58, respectively, were hidden. The persons in question did not have travel documents and did not meet the legal conditions for entry into Romania," specifies the General Inspectorate of the Border Police.
The two migrants as well as the means of transport were handed over to the Bulgarian border authorities in order to continue the investigations.
